15 Killed, 16 Injured as Bus Falls Off Road in Udhampur
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

Udhampur, Apr 20 (JKNS): At least fifteen persons were killed and sixteen others injured after a passenger bus skidded off the road in the Ramnagar area of Udhampur district on Monday, officials said.

Officials told news agency JKNS that immediately after the incident, police, rescue teams and locals rushed to the spot and launched a rescue operation.

They said 15 persons died in the mishap while 16 others sustained injuries and were shifted to nearby hospitals for treatment.

Meanwhile, Union Minister Dr Jitendra Singh said he spoke to the Deputy Commissioner Udhampur soon after the accident and is closely monitoring the situation.

He said rescue operations were launched promptly and all possible assistance is being provided. “The injured are being shifted for treatment and arrangements are underway to airlift the critically injured. I am in constant touch with the local administration,” he said.

 

Lieutenant Governor Manoj Sinha also expressed grief over the loss of lives, extending condolences to the bereaved families and praying for the speedy recovery of the injured. He said necessary directions have been issued to the district administration, Police, SDRF and Health Department to ensure all possible help to those affected.

 

Chief Minister Omar Abdullah also expressed deep sorrow over the incident, stating that the government stands with the victims’ families and all required assistance is being extended.

 

Former CM Mehbooba Mufti also expressed grief and siad, “Deeply saddened by the tragic Udhampur-Ramnagar bus accident in which twelve people lost their lives. Condolences to the bereaved families & pray for the swift recovery of those injured.” (JKNS)
